  6. Alot has been said here about these units, good and bad. My opinion may not be that valid due to this is the first GPS that I have personally owned, however I have spent a fair amount of time researching and playing with other GPS units. To get aquainted with our units (2 of) we have been playing a type of GPS tag out in our 40 acre almond orchard (we also venture out in the neighbors orchards as well). So far we have tested up to about a 1 mile range with no complications. Flawless on the peer-to-peer and next to flawless with the FRS radio. My 11 year old son likes to start talking before or right when he begins speaking. When using the radio one must use a slower speaking speed and use clear text communication. The real test will be in the mountains while backpacking. Hope this helps. Merry Christmas to all! Hotphoot
